The Pathology Assistant (PA) is responsible for (1) case accessioning (when needed); (2) gross description and sampling of low complexity tissue specimens; (3) act as diener during autopsies; (4) preparation and collection of tissue for special studies; (5) cutting, staining, and cover slipping of frozen section tissue; (6) maintaining supplies of gross room/morgue; (7) disposal of old specimens; (8) identify and resolve labeling/identification discrepancies.
